The High Court has declared lockdown alert Level 3 and 4 regulations unconstitutional and invalid. The court suspended the declaration of invalidity for 14 days, which means that Level 3 regulations remain for now.
Reyno de Beer, who lodged the court challenge on behalf of the Liberty Fighters network speaks further on the issue.
